Abstract
The embodiment of the invention provides a kind of background application management method and terminals.This method comprises: showing the background application list of the terminal according to the initial priority of the application program of the terminal;User is received for the adjustment input of application program in the background application list;It is inputted in response to the adjustment, confirms the hang-up sequence of the application program and the free memory threshold value of the terminal;It according to the hang-up sequence, controls the terminal and successively hangs up the application program, until the system free memory of the terminal is greater than or equal to the free memory threshold value.The present invention is interacted by terminal and user, to improve to the hang-up sequence of each application program in backstage and to the accuracy of system free memory control.

Background technique
Currently, as the application scenarios of the terminals such as mobile phone, computer are more and more, the application program of terminal installation is also increasingly
It is more, but the running memory of the mobile terminals such as mobile phone is usually very limited, it, can if user starts multiple application programs
Cause the system free memory of terminal to gradually decrease, the problem of operation Caton occurs so as to cause terminal.So in order to guarantee end
End system operation is smooth, can all have the administrative mechanism of a set of background application in the operating system of terminal.A kind of Managed Solution
To hang up part background application when system free memory is lower than default memory threshold, also will accordingly using into
Journey is killed, thus releasing memory;It is there are also a kind of Managed Solution, when system free memory is lower than default memory threshold, to portion
The memory for dividing background application to occupy is compressed, thus releasing memory.
But in place of existing background application management method Shortcomings, for the first scheme, need answering from backstage
One or more application is selected to be hung up according to priority in list, but currently existing scheme can not be accurately to answering from the background
Priority is ranked up, and background application administrative mechanism is not interacted with user, is easy to cause and is accidentally hung up background application
Program is unable to satisfy the demand of user.For second scheme, memory compression needs a large amount of CPU (Central
Processing Unit, central processing unit) it calculates, cpu resource is occupied, so that foreground application is easy to cause to run Caton,
Increase the power consumption of system simultaneously, and when background application is switched to foreground, needs to solve the memory compressed
Compression causes application program from having delay when being switched to foreground from the background.

Embodiment one
Referring to Fig.1, a kind of flow chart of the management method of background application of one embodiment of the invention is shown, is answered
For terminal, the method can specifically include following steps:
Step 110, according to the initial priority of the application program of the terminal, the background application column of the terminal are shown
Table.
Background application list therein refers to the program listing contained in the application program of terminal running background.It is existing
Mobile operating system can all provide interface and obtain background application list for application, which can determine wherein according to certain algorithm
Application program initial priority, the chronological order on backstage is such as entered by application program, passes through opening for application program
Dynamic chronological order, or the initial priority according to the determining each application program in backstage such as visibility of application program.?
In the embodiment of the present invention, the initial priority of each application program in background application list can be confirmed using any methods availalbe,
This embodiment of the present invention is not limited.It is answered furthermore, it is possible to get backstage already sorted using any methods availalbe
With list, this embodiment of the present invention is also not limited.
Moreover, showing the background application column of the terminal according to the initial priority of application program in background application list
Table.Specifically it can show the application list according to the sequence of application program initial priority from low to high, certainly may be used
With the sequence according to the initial priority of application program from high to low, the application list, etc. is shown.Moreover, being particularly shown
The mode of the application list can be preset according to demand, be not limited to this embodiment of the present invention.
Step 120, user is received for the adjustment input of application program in the background application list.
It has been observed that being based on each using journey in background application list in the background application management method of the prior art
The sequence of the initial priority of sequence from low to high, hangs up background application, until the system free memory of terminal is big
In or equal to default free memory threshold value.But on the one hand, different terminals user and same terminal user are in different moments
Demand may be varied, then it wishes that the application program hung up also can be accordingly varied.But currently existing scheme can not
Accurately the priority of background application is ranked up, causes accidentally to hang up background application.For example, according to application program into
The sequencing for entering backstage determines the priority of each application program, lower more the priority for the application program for being introduced into backstage, that
Assume that the music playing process A in the background application list of present terminal enters backstage at first, but user is utilizing always
Music playing process A listens to music, then according to existing background application management method, if the system of terminal is idle
Memory is greater than initial memory threshold value, then controlling terminal can hang up music playing process A at first, and then lead to music playing process
A dodges on backstage to move back, and influences user and normally listens to music.Still further aspect, initial memory threshold value be it is relatively-stationary, be unable to satisfy
All usage scenarios lead to the problem of being easy to appear Caton when starting the application program of certain big memories.For example setting is initial
Memory threshold is 300M (MByte, Mbytes), if that terminal start one be more than 300M application program will lead to be
Free memory of uniting is insufficient, slack-off so as to cause the starting of application program.

Step 140, it according to the hang-up sequence, controls the terminal and successively hangs up the application program, until described
The system free memory of terminal is greater than or equal to the free memory threshold value.
It, then can be with after the free memory threshold value of application priority and corresponding terminal that each application program has been determined
It according to the hang-up sequence, controls the terminal and successively hangs up the application program, until in the system free time of the terminal
It deposits and is greater than or equal to the free memory threshold value.
For example, it is assumed that the extension of the application program and each application program that include in the background application list currently got
It is as follows to play sequence:
Application program 1, application program 2, application program 3
Assuming that application program 1 is 50M in backstage committed memory, application program 2 is 80M in backstage committed memory, using journey
Sequence 3 is 100M in backstage committed memory, and free memory threshold value adjusted is 300M.If the current system free memory of terminal
Less than 300M, then controlling terminal can be hung up by application program 1 first, and if after application program 1 is hung up, terminal is current
System free memory then can further controlling terminal hang up application program 2 still less than 300M, and so on, until eventually
The system free memory at end, which is greater than or equal to 300M, can then stop pending operation.
It can certainly first determine to meet the system free memory of dynamic terminal more than or equal to the free memory threshold
Value, the application program for needing to hang up.For example, for above-mentioned terminal, it is assumed that current system free memory is 200M, then for
System free memory is adjusted to more than or is equal to the free memory threshold value, then needs above-mentioned application program 1 and answers
It is successively hung up with program 2.
